Traveling to Canada from the USA without a visa is possible for U.S. citizens. However, you require a valid passport or passport card, and at times, additional documentation may be necessary based on the purpose and length of stay. If you are not a U.S. citizen, check specific eligibility and documentation requirements for your country before planning your trip.
